Cinnamon Muffins

Cinnamon Muffins feature a soft, tender crumb infused with cinnamon throughout the batter and topped with a cinnamon sugar sprinkle. The combination of all-purpose flour, sugar, and baking powder creates a light texture, while cinnamon adds warm, sweet spice. These muffins offer a cozy, subtly spiced flavor and a slightly crunchy cinnamon sugar topping, making them suited for breakfast or a simple snack.

Description

The Cinnamon Muffins recipe uses a classic muffin batter with flour, sugar, baking powder, cinnamon, salt, milk, vegetable oil, and eggs. The dry ingredients are mixed separately from wet, then combined carefully to avoid overmixing, preserving a delicate crumb. Topping the batter with a cinnamon and sugar mixture before baking provides a sweet, crisp layer on the muffins' surface.

Baked at 375°F, the muffins rise moderately, delivering a soft, moist texture inside with a cinnamon-sugar kissed crust. The cinnamon flavor is present inside the muffins and accentuated on top, creating a balanced warmth in each bite. These muffins are straightforward, relying on staple pantry ingredients and a simple preparation method.

The recipe notes that the amount of baking powder was reduced for a less intense rise but maintains good texture and flavor. These muffins work well for breakfast, teatime treats, or light snack occasions.

Ingredients

Servings
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up sugar
  • 1 tablespoon baking powder
  • 1 tablespoon cinnamon
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up milk
  • 1/2 cup vegetable oil (or another neutral oil)
  • 2 egg
  • 2 tablespoons sugar
  • 1 teaspoon cinnamon

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 375ºF.  Grease 18 muffins cups.
  2. In a bowl, combine the flour, sugar, baking powder, cinnamon and salt.
  3. In another bowl, beat together the milk, vegetable oil, and eggs.  Make a well in the center of the dry ingredients and add the wet ingredients.  Stir just until combined - don’t over mix.
  4. Divide the mixture evenly between the prepared muffin cups.
  5. In a small bowl, combine the 2 tablespoons sugar and 1 teaspoon of cinnamon.  Sprinkle the cinnamon sugar mixture over the tops of the batter filled cups.  
  6. Bake the muffins until a toothpick instead in the center comes out clean, 13-15 minutes.

Notes

  • The recipe has been adjusted to use 1 tablespoon of baking powder instead of 4 teaspoons, which still produces good muffin rise and texture.
